The Role of Ground Operations in Safe Air Travel

Ground operations play a crucial role in the safety, efficiency, and reliability of every flight. Although passengers typically focus on what happens inside the aircraft or during the flight itself, much of aviation safety begins long before takeoff and continues long after landing. Ground crews manage complex tasks that include guiding aircraft, maintaining equipment, inspecting components, monitoring safety protocols, and coordinating with flight crews and airport personnel. These responsibilities require precision, training, and specialized tools. Simple yet vital items such as pitot covers help protect sensitive instruments and prevent errors that could compromise aircraft performance. Understanding the importance of ground operations provides insight into how multiple teams work together to create a safe and predictable travel experience.

Aircraft Arrival and Initial Assessment

Ground operations begin when an aircraft arrives at the gate. Trained personnel guide the aircraft into position, ensuring safe clearance from equipment, buildings, and other aircraft. Once the aircraft reaches a complete stop, the ground crew secures wheel chocks and connects external power sources if needed. These initial tasks support safety and prepare the aircraft for servicing. Ground crews also perform a quick visual inspection, looking for signs of damage such as worn tires, fluid leaks, or dents that may require further evaluation. Early detection allows maintenance teams to address issues before the next flight. These preliminary assessments form the foundation of safe turnaround procedures.

Passenger Services and Cabin Preparation

As passengers disembark, another side of ground operations begins inside the aircraft. Cleaning teams prepare the cabin by sanitizing surfaces, restocking supplies, and organizing seating areas. Efficient cabin preparation supports both safety and comfort by ensuring that emergency equipment is accessible; aisles remain clear, and seating areas are ready for new passengers. These teams work under strict time constraints but must still follow safety standards that protect both staff and travelers. When cabin preparation is completed efficiently and accurately, it supports on time performance and contributes to a positive passenger experience.

Maintenance Checks and System Protection

Maintenance teams play a central role in ground operations. They perform detailed evaluations of aircraft systems, including electrical components, landing gear, hydraulic systems, and navigation instruments. These assessments must be conducted according to established guidelines to verify operational readiness. One critical part of the process involves protecting sensitive equipment from debris, insects, or contaminants. Items such as high-quality pitot covers are used to shield important sensors that measure airspeed and atmospheric pressure. Without these protective measures, sensor obstruction could lead to inaccurate readings during flight. Maintenance crews rely on both specialized tools and simple protective devices to ensure that all systems remain functional and safe.

Fueling, Weight Distribution, and Ground Support Coordination

Fueling is another essential part of ground operations. Fueling crews determine the correct amount of fuel based on flight distance, weather conditions, and aircraft requirements. Inaccurate fueling can affect flight performance and safety. At the same time, baggage crews coordinate loading procedures to maintain proper weight distribution. Load planners calculate how cargo and luggage should be arranged to support stable handling during takeoff and landing. Fueling teams, load planners, and maintenance crews must communicate clearly to ensure that each step aligns with established standards. This coordination helps maintain predictable aircraft performance and prevents delays.

Security Procedures and Safety Protocols

Ground operations also include important security measures that protect passengers, crew members, and airport staff. Security teams inspect service vehicles, monitor restricted areas, and enforce protocols designed to prevent unauthorized access. Ground personnel follow detailed procedures for handling equipment, storing tools, and moving vehicles around active aircraft. These safety practices minimize the risk of incidents on the ramp. Proper communication between teams ensures awareness of ongoing activities and reduces the likelihood of operational conflicts. When all groups follow safety guidelines consistently, the result is a secure and controlled working environment.

Pre-Departure Checks and Final Ground Crew Actions

Before an aircraft departs, final checks are conducted by both ground crews and flight crews. Maintenance teams remove protective equipment such as static port guards and pitot tube coverings. Flight crews verify that all ground equipment has been removed and that the aircraft is ready for pushback. Pushback crews then reposition the aircraft and guide it safely onto the taxiway. Every action at this stage must be precise, as errors can affect both safety and schedule reliability. The coordination of these final steps reflects the expertise and discipline required within ground operations.
